I received the following message form journalist and friend Stephen Grey, who spent the last five years researching extraordinary renditionsand tracking down “disappeared” Islamist suspects in the US-run global gulag…

FYI – some exclusive material posted today on www.ghostplane.net, the website of my book Ghost Plane, which is out now.For the first time, I’ve now posted on the Internet all available flight logs I have of the CIA’s alleged fleet of aircraft. Compiled from aviation sources it is a searchable database (by country, date, airport etc) that gives a portrait not only of renditions but wider CIA activity since September 11. Have also posted a timeline, including details of new renditions, that helps interpret what the flight logs show.
(See www.ghostplane.net/note and www.ghostplane.net/node/26, which describes some of the surprises )

Also posted today –
- A CIA rendition in documents – the aviation documents and Spanish records that show proof of the pilots and the companies responsible, including a private subsidiary of Boeing, for organising the rendition of Khaled el Masri, the German citizen, from Macedonia to Afghanistan. www.ghostplane.net/elmasri

- My rendition and torture – the story of Abu Omar, the Islamist kidnapped in Milan in February 2003 by the CIA, according to Italian prosecutors – his story in full as told in an account (translated from Arabic, original also posted) smuggled out of Egypt’s infamous Torah prison. His account of his interrogation is chilling. www.ghostplane.net/abuomar.
